AI-Powered SEO: Navigating the Future of Search in 2026
In an era where Google Search Generative Experience (SGE) and other AI-powered search engines play a pivotal role, traditional SEO methods might no longer suffice. AEO Tools are indispensable for marketers looking to understand and optimize website content to align with the complex, AI-driven algorithms effectively.
Why is AI Critical for SEO in 2026?
AI processes vast amounts of data, including search behavior, user intent, and content gaps, enabling you to create content that deeply resonates with your target audience and performs optimally for AI algorithms.
Leading AEO Tools
- SurferSEO & Clearscope: These continue to be leaders in content analysis and keyword recommendations, helping structure articles for conversational search queries.
- Semrush & Ahrefs (AI-enhanced features): These robust tools have integrated AI capabilities to assist with competitor analysis, identify long-tail keyword opportunities, and predict future search trends, allowing for proactive SEO strategy planning.
- Local SEO AI Tools: Specialized tools leveraging AI to analyze reviews, Q&A sections, and local business data to enhance visibility in regional search results.

Intelligent Marketing Automation: Enhanced Efficiency with AI
Marketing Automation has evolved far beyond simple email scheduling. AI has transformed it into a sophisticated, intelligent system capable of learning, adapting, and responding to customer behavior in real-time.
How AI Elevates Marketing Automation
AI empowers Marketing Automation platforms to conduct deep customer data analysis, create precise segmentation, and personalize the customer journey at every stage, from awareness to loyal advocacy.
Marketing Automation Platforms to Watch
- HubSpot & Salesforce Marketing Cloud: Remain strong platforms, now augmented with advanced AI capabilities for campaign creation, lead management, and more complex analytical insights.
- Braze & Iterable: Emphasize AI-driven personalization and seamless multi-channel customer engagement, ideal for crafting omnichannel experiences.
- Adobe Marketo Engage: Stands out with AI-powered lead scoring, behavioral analysis, and the design of conversion-focused B2B campaigns.

Natural Language Processing (NLP) and Conversational AI: Smarter Communication
NLP is the core technology enabling AI to understand and respond to human language naturally. It plays a crucial role in shaping customer interactions in the digital age.
NLP's Role in 2026 Marketing
NLP not only makes chatbots and voice assistants smarter but also helps analyze customer sentiment from vast amounts of text and generate effective content.
Applications of NLP and Conversational AI
- Intelligent Chatbots and Virtual Assistants: Beyond basic queries, 2026's NLP and Generative AI-powered chatbots can handle complex questions, provide personalized product recommendations, and even complete sales.
- Advanced Sentiment Analysis: AI accurately analyzes customer opinions from social media, product reviews, and various feedback channels, allowing you to understand market sentiment and adjust strategies promptly.
- Content Generation & Optimization: AI tools like ChatGPT, Google Gemini, or Claude can assist in drafting articles, social media posts, ad copy, and emails, adapting to different tones and target audiences.
Notable NLP and Generative AI Tools
- ChatGPT & Google Gemini: Generative AI platforms that have advanced significantly, capable of creating text, code, images, and even videos to support marketing content creation.
- IBM Watson & Azure AI Language: Enterprise-grade solutions offering advanced NLP capabilities for deep customer data analysis and superior customer experience creation.

How to Implement AI in Your 2026 Marketing Strategy
- Define Clear Objectives: Start by identifying specific business problems or opportunities where AI can assist, e.g., increasing organic traffic by 20% or reducing customer service response time by 30%.
- Select the Right Tools: Evaluate your needs and budget to choose the most suitable AI tools, whether comprehensive platforms or specialized solutions.
- Invest in Workforce Development: Provide training for your team to acquire the knowledge and skills necessary to use AI tools and understand their underlying principles.
- Blend Human Creativity with AI: AI is a powerful assistant, but human creativity, strategic decision-making, and contextual understanding remain vital for crafting outstanding and meaningful campaigns.

Related Questions (FAQs)
How does AEO differ from traditional SEO?
AEO leverages artificial intelligence to analyze more complex data, such as deep search intent, user behavior within SGE, and future keyword trends. This enables you to create content that precisely addresses both AI and user needs, unlike traditional SEO which primarily focuses on keywords and links.
How should small businesses start using AI in marketing?
Small businesses should begin by identifying specific problems they want to solve, such as saving time on content creation or improving customer response. Then, choose accessible, specialized AI tools like user-friendly AI content generators or chatbot platforms.
What are the precautions for using AI in Marketing Automation?
While AI is highly efficient, you should be mindful of customer data privacy, verifying the accuracy of AI-generated content, and maintaining a balance between automation and human touch to prevent customers from feeling overlooked.
Will Generative AI replace human marketers?
Generative AI will serve as a powerful assistant, reducing repetitive tasks and boosting content creation efficiency. However, it will not fully replace human marketers. Human input remains essential for strategic planning, creative ideation, ethical decision-making, and building genuine customer relationships.
How can we measure the success of AI implementation in marketing?
Success can be measured through clear Key Performance Indicators (KPIs), such as increased organic traffic from AEO, higher conversion rates from marketing automation, reduced customer response times from chatbots, and the overall ROI of AI-driven campaigns.
